US X3 in Korea, console inop

Is the media head unit resettable without a BMW supplied diagnostic system?

We have a 2014 US X3 in South Korea xDrive28i, and the console/screen died; no rear cam, no radio, no start up/BMW logo and so on. Tried disconnecting/reconnecting battery, and checked the fuses, all good. Have a warning lamp on the dash, yellow diamond with exclamation mark.

Next available dealer appointment isn't until December.

Any DIY reset options?
---
Also, are there any flat screen options for this make and model, something that will allow Apple Play and map apps? The dealer shared that it's not possible to load a Korean map for Nav, this model also doesn't have a Korean language option. I suspect adding an aftermarket screen over here might not be an option?
